My First Castle Panic is a cooperative board game that can be enjoyed by children aged 4 and over, as well as adults.
Released by Fireside Games in 2019 and created by game designer Justin De Witt, this title offers a special experience that will strengthen family bonds.
- Cooperative play : All players work as a team to protect the castle
- Suitable ages : from children aged 4 and over to adults
- Number of players : 1 to a maximum of 4
- Play time : Complete in about 20 minutes
- Textless design : intuitive play with color and shape symbol matching
- Awards : ASTRA "Best Toy for Kids 2019" finalist
- Stunning visuals : 26 expressive monster tokens

■ Product Introduction
[The appeal of cooperative games]
The biggest feature of this game is that all players work as a team to defend the castle.
Capture monsters coming from the forest and capture them all before the wall is destroyed.
Rather than competing with each other, everyone works together to win, which naturally leads to communication.
[Simple yet strategic gameplay]
There are no letters on the cards or board, and the game is based on symbol matching of colors and shapes.
Even children who cannot read can play intuitively, and the game can be completed in a short time of about 20 minutes, allowing them to maintain their concentration while having fun.
Draw and place monster tokens from the bag, then match the symbols on the board with the hero cards in your hand to capture monsters.
By discussing the game with other players, players can naturally develop their strategic thinking and problem-solving skills.
Game components include a colorful game board, castle walls and three towers, and 26 expressive monster tokens.
